PAR operates across two segments — Restaurant/Retail and Government — with its Restaurant/Retail arm offering cloud-based POS solutions, loyalty platforms like Punchh, and back-office tools under the Data Central brand. Key catalysts to watch for PAR in 2026 include execution on its cloud POS and loyalty platform expansion, particularly Brink POS and Punchh adoption among enterprise restaurant chains. The 86 open roles could signal headcount growth ahead of product launches or geographic expansion. Risks include competitive pressure in restaurant tech from larger players, potential margin compression from ongoing R&D spend, and limited visibility into government segment contract flow.
